Geographer, Hispanist, former State Secretary and cultural diplomat in Madrid. His public interests and research have been summarised in several independent volumes.

His poems are philosophical, while his short stories are mostly historically inspired. He has published numerous small studies and short stories. He has translated major Spanish authors (Borges, Quiroga), and his poetry translations (G. Lorca, C. Coronado, C. Janés, Jang Lian) are also faithful to form.

Chairman of the Board of Trustees of the Janus Pannonius Prize Foundation.
